    Hi Martin,

    I've had the same exact problem since I upgraded to Windows 10 from 7 a few weeks ago. My MX5500 mouse and keyboard still don't work after a reboot.  However, a relatively quick and easy work around is to just unplug the Logitech USB dongle, wait a couple of seconds and plug it back in.  After doing this, my mouse and keyboard work until the next power down/reboot. I don't power down or reboot my desktop very often and the mouse and keyboard continues to work after coming out of sleep.  But, to make unplugging and plugging back in a little easier, I use a USB extension cord for the dongle and have it resting on my desk so it is much easier to unplug and plug back in.

    So try unplugging the USB dongle for the MX 5500 and plugging it back in and the mouse and keyboard should start working - until the next reboot!
